If a mixture is made by combining 5 liters of a 10% solution with 15 liters of a 20% solution, what is the overall percentage concentration of the solution?
Step 1: Calculate the amount of acid in the 10% solution. Multiply 5 liters by 0.10 (10%). This gives you 0.5 liters of acid.
Step 2: Calculate the amount of acid in the 20% solution. Multiply 15 liters by 0.20 (20%). This gives you 3 liters of acid.
Step 3: Add the amounts of acid from both solutions together. 0.5 liters + 3 liters = 3.5 liters of acid.
Step 4: Calculate the total volume of the mixture. Add 5 liters and 15 liters together. This gives you 20 liters of total solution.
Step 5: Calculate the overall percentage concentration. Divide the total acid (3.5 liters) by the total volume (20 liters) and multiply by 100. (3.5 / 20) * 100 = 17.5%.
